IMPERIAL PREFERENCE.
A UNIONIST PREDICTION. By Teloeraph-Prcss A»Boomtion—OoDyrleht (Ree. March 8, 5.5 p.m.) London, March 7. Fifteen -hundred delegates attended the Tariff Reform Leaguo's conference. Mr. Austen Chamberlain (Unionist), in a letter, regretted tbo Unionist Party's changed attitude on the fiscal issue, .but they must do the'best possiblo with the preseiit programme. Speaking at the banquet Mr. Chamberlain predicted tho early return of a Glove'rnment who would establish Imperial preference, which, once established, no earthly power would, shake. ■
